A METHOD FOR CHECKING THE FUNCTIONALITY OF INDIVIDUAL PUMPING ELEMENTS OF A HIGH-PRESSURE PUMP IN A HIGH-PRESSURE ACCUMULATOR FUEL INJECTION SYSTEM

摘要

In a method for checking the functionality of individual pumping elements of a high-pressure pump (6) in a high-pressure accumulator fuel injection system of an internal combustion engine (1) this is done by driving the pump while demanding a high fuel flow therefrom and simultaneously controlling the injector(-s) (5) connected to the accumulator to be closed. The pressure inside the accumulator is measured at a high frequency resulting in a plurality of pressure measuring values during each stroke of a pumping element (7, 8) and it is determined that there is a malfunction of a pumping element (7, 8) when it has a development of pressure measuring values increasing less than a predetermined proportion of the development of pressure measuring values of the pumping element having a development with the highest increase.
